A member asked:

Trimalleolar ankle fracture surgery. what is the chance of painfree recovery?

7 doctors weighed in across 2 answers

Many variables: Results from ankle fracture management depend on the surgeon's ability to obtain "perfect" alignment as very subtle discrepancies can have profound affects on ankle mechanics. Cartilage damage which may have occurred at the time of injury can predispose the joint to arthritis despite optimal surgical treatment. All trimalleolar fractures areen't "equal" so it's difficult to make predictions.
